    If you're looking to buy a Kia Carnival, Dinamikjaya Motors, listed under Bermaz Auto, has introduced its “Fuel-on-Us” campaign to ease the diesel price hike in Malaysia. The three-month campaign applies to any Kia Carnival variant registered between 1-October and 31-December 2024. New Kia Carnival owners will benefit from a RM 1.05 per litre diesel subsidy for the next five years, no matter how fuel prices fluctuate weekly.     BYD’s luxury sub-brand Denza revealed official images of the Denza N9 which will serve as its flagship SUV model. Built on BYD’s e-Platform 3.0, the N9 (no, it definitely does not stand for Negeri Sembilan) is expected to launch later this year with fully electric (BEV) and plug-in hybrid (PHEV) powertrains.     Perodua is gearing up for a new era with the next-generation Myvi, and according to our friends at Funtasticko, the design for the fourth-generation model, codenamed D01D, has already been finalised. The all-new D01D Perodua Myvi, slated for a 2025 launch, will be built on the Daihatsu New Global Architecture (DNGA) platform, shared with other models like the upcoming D66B Nexis SUV.     Tesla’s glitzy We, Robot event in Los Angeles on Friday morning (our local time) ended on a high note, with fans giving Elon Musk thunderous applause when he unveiled the ‘no steering wheel, no pedals, no charging port’ Tesla Cybercab and Robovan. Investors, however, saw it differently, and proceeded to dump even more of the company’s stocks.
